Abstract :
In this work experimental data for the refractive index on mixing for butyl acetate + (toluene, ethylbenzene, p-xylene, isopropylbenzene, butylbenzene, isobutylbenzene, mesitylene, or t-butylbenzene) binary mixtures, and some computed derived properties, as a function of temperature, are preseInted. The mixtures show a clear expansive trend for the highest molar mass compounds. Values of measured properties were compared with results obtained by semiempirical relations and equations of state with simple mixing rules. Accurate results were obtained with the latter, and such parameters could be used in the prediction of multicomponent refractive indices or other thermodynamic properties using standard thermodynamic expressions.
